Civil Service Customer Satisfaction Survey 2015

Published by Department of Public Expenditure Infrastructure Public Service Reform and Digitalisation

The [results of a survey of Civil Service customers](http://www.per.gov.ie/minister-for-public-expenditure-and-reform-publishes-results-of-civil-service-customer-satisfaction-survey-2015/) were published on 6 May, 2015\. The purpose of the survey was to ascertain satisfaction levels with services received, as well as more general perceptions of, and attitudes to, the Civil Service. The survey was carried out to meet a commitment in the [Government’s Public Service Reform Plan 2014-2016](http://www.reformplan.per.gov.ie/) to “commission, deliver and disseminate the results of a Civil Service customer satisfaction survey”. The survey also delivers on a commitment in the [Civil Service Renewal Plan](http://www.per.gov.ie/civil-service-renewal/) to “run regular surveys of Civil Service customers to more fully understand user experiences, expectations and requirements”. The survey was undertaken by Ipsos MRBI on behalf of the Department of Public Expenditure and Reform.
